Pathogen Detection: Safe Dairy Products with Condagene® qPCR Kits


The dairy industry remains one of the largest and most significant sectors worldwide. World milk production is projected to rise by 177 million tons by 2025, maintaining an average annual growth rate of 1.8% over the next decade.

This growth underscores the vital role dairy products play in global nutrition and the economy, driven by increasing demand in both developed and developing nations.

The health and well-being benefits of dairy products are well-documented, emphasizing the need for stringent microbiological control. Among the bacterial pathogens of concern in raw milk and other dairy products are:

  • Salmonella spp.
  • Listeria monocytogenes
  • Escherichia coli O157:H7 and STEC
  • Campylobacter jejuni
  • Staphylococcus aureus
  • Bacillus cereus
  • Yersinia enterocolitica

Effective and rapid detection of these pathogens is crucial to ensure consumer safety and maintain public health standards. To address these challenges, PCR (Polymerase Chain Reaction) has emerged as the preferred method for pathogen detection.
